What is Expressive Arts Therapy?
In expressive arts therapy, we provide a safe container to allow the transformative power of the arts to come through. When immersed in creative exploration, we experience a different way of being than in our daily lives. This allows us to gain insight, see new perspectives and uncover unseen resources.
A typical therapy session will start with us talking about what is currently present in your life, and then we will move into an exploration with the arts. We may use a combination of modalities including painting, sculpture, collage, poetry, storytelling, movement, and sound. After the arts-based exploration, we have time for reflection and closing.
In group settings, working with the expressive arts allows multiple layers to unfold. Each person brings something to the group dynamic making it a truly unique process every time. This opportunity allows participants to discover aspects of their personal and interpersonal lives by being present to what is emerging for others.
No previous experience with the arts is required for either individual or group work. This work is process-oriented rather than product-oriented, however, you may find yourself pleasantly surprised at what you do make!
